top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

            如何编译TCC比特币钱包:完整指南

            • 2025-07-11 03:39:21
                
                

                比特币作为一种数字货币,已经引起了全球范围内的关注,而比特币钱包则是存储、接收和发送比特币的重要工具。TCC(Trusted Coin Client)是一个相对较新的比特币钱包,提供了一些独特的功能和安全性。而编译这一钱包,对于开发者或者有稍微技术背景的用户来说,可能是一个值得学习的过程。本文将详细介绍如何编译TCC比特币钱包,并回答相关的一些问题,以帮助读者更加深入地理解和使用这一工具。

                为什么需要编译自己的比特币钱包?

                可能有人会问,为什么不直接使用现成的比特币钱包软件,反而要花时间去编译一个自己的钱包?答案主要有以下几个方面:

                首先,自编译钱包使用户拥有更高的控制权。当你自己编译比特币钱包时,你可以对其进行个性化设置,配置满足你的需求和喜好。这意味着在用户体验和功能上,你可以进行更自由的调整。

                其次,通过编译可以增强安全性。开源的软件通常会经历更为严格的审查和测试。当你从源码编译TCC比特币钱包时,你可以确保使用最新的安全补丁,并且避免由于使用过时软件而产生的安全风险。

                最后,自编译钱包使得用户更加深入地理解比特币的工作原理。在编译过程中,你将接触到比特币的许多核心概念以及技术细节,这对任何想要成为比特币技术专家的人来说,都是极好的学习机会。

                编译TCC比特币钱包的步骤

                编译TCC比特币钱包的过程虽然看起来复杂,但只要按照步骤进行,是可以顺利完成的。下面是详细的步骤说明:

                1. 准备开发环境

                在开始编译之前,你需要确保系统中安装了一些必要的工具和库。通常情况下,你需要安装以下一些工具:

                • Git:用于从GitHub下载源代码。
                • Qt:一个跨平台的应用程序开发框架,TCC的用户界面依赖于Qt。
                • CMake:用于构建项目的工具。
                • 编译器:如gcc(Linux)或Visual Studio(Windows)等。

                确保你已经安装了以上所有工具,并且它们的路径已经配置好,以便在终端或命令行中可以直接调用。

                2. 克隆TCC源码

                使用Git命令将TCC比特币钱包的源代码克隆到你的本地机器上。打开终端,输入以下命令:

                git clone https://github.com/your_tcc_repository_link.git

                替换为实际的TCC存储库链接。该命令会创建一个名为“TCC”的文件夹,里面包含所有源代码文件。

                3. 编译项目

                进入TCC文件夹,创建一个新的构建目录,并进入该目录。在此目录下,使用CMake构建项目:

                mkdir build
                cd build
                cmake ..
                make

                这个过程可能需要一些时间,你会看到编译器输出的信息。如果编译成功,你应该能在build目录下看到可执行的程序。

                4. 运行钱包

                成功编译后,进入可执行文件的目录,运行TCC比特币钱包。可以通过以下命令来运行:

                ./TCCWallet

                如果没有出错,你应该能看到TCC比特币钱包的界面,接下来你可以进行设置和使用了。

                如何解决编译过程中遇到的问题?

                编译过程中,经常会遇到各种各样的问题,特别是缺少库文件、编译错误或环境配置问题。以下是一些常见的问题及其解决方案:

                1. 缺少依赖库

                在编译过程中,系统可能会提示缺少某些依赖库。你需要确保安装了所有必要的库,可以参考TCC的文档来确认所有的依赖项。一般而言,你可以通过包管理器(如apt、brew或者yum)来安装缺失的库。例如:

                sudo apt install <缺失库名称>

                2. 编译错误

                编译错误可能是由多种原因引起的,最常见的原因是源代码不完整或因为版本不兼容导致的。确保你正在使用最新版本的源代码,并仔细阅读编译输出中的错误信息,此外,也可以在GitHub上查看是否有人遇到相同的问题并找到解决方案。

                3. 环境配置问题

                环境变量的配置不当也可能导致编译失败,确保你的PATH环境变量正确指向了编译器和CMake等工具的安装路径。如果是在Windows环境下,确保Visual Studio的命令行工具已正确安装并配置。

                4. 运行问题

                即使编译成功,运行时也有可能遇到问题。这通常与配置文件、权限设置或者平台兼容性有关。确保在运行程序前已正确配置钱包的环境,例如正确设置数据目录和相关权限。

                5. 社区支持

                最后,很多时候,当我们遇到自己解决不了的问题时,寻求社区的帮助会是一个有效的方案。可通过比特币社区论坛、StackOverflow或TCC的Github页面来提出问题,通常会有许多经验丰富的用户提供支持。

                使用TCC比特币钱包的基本操作

                成功编译并运行TCC比特币钱包之后,你需要了解一些基本操作。以下是一些关键的操作步骤:

                1. 创建新钱包

                运行钱包后,你需要首先创建一个新的钱包。按照界面提示,选择创建新钱包,设置安全密码以确保钱包安全。密码越复杂越好,但也要确保能记住。

                2. 导入已有钱包

                如果你已经有旧的钱包需要恢复,可以选择“导入钱包”选项,输入种子短语或私钥进行恢复。请确保这些信息的安全,切勿公开。

                3. 收发比特币

                在钱包界面中,你可以找到“收款”和“付款”选项。为了收款,你需要分享你的接收地址,而发送的时候则需要对方的地址和要发送的比特币数量。请仔细核对地址信息,以免发送错误。

                4. 查看交易记录

                TCC钱包会记录所有的交易信息,你可以在“交易记录”选项中查看,了解过去的发送和接收记录。这一功能非常实用,可以帮助你追踪钱包的使用情况。

                5. 安全备份

                为了避免在数据丢失时造成不可逆转的损失,务必定期备份钱包数据。通常可以在设置中找到备份选项,选择保存到安全位置,并记住备份的路径。

                相关常见问题

                为了更好地理解TCC比特币钱包,下面是5个相关的常见问题,以及每个问题的详细解答:

                1. TCC比特币钱包与其他钱包有何区别?

                TCC比特币钱包在功能上相较于其他钱包,具有一些独特之处。例如,它支持多重签名和增量备份等功能,这在一定程度上增加了安全性。同时,TCC比特币钱包注重用户隐私,不会记录用户的任何交易信息。此外,其用户界面也较为友好,适合初学者使用。

                2. 如何确保钱包的安全性?

                钱包的安全性主要体现在多个方面。首先,设置强密码并定期更换是基本要求。其次,保持软件更新,及时下载最新版的TCC钱包,能避免已知的安全漏洞。第三,使用多重签名功能能进一步提升安全性,还可以考虑将多余的比特币存储在冷钱包中,减少在线风险。

                3. 遇到比特币充值未到账该怎么办?

                如果在使用TCC进行充值时出现未到账的情况,首先应检查交易状态。可以通过区块链浏览器查询交易是否被矿工确认。如果确认未被处理,可能是由于交易费用设置过低,导致交易未能有效处理。在确认处理情况后,需耐心等待,正常情况下,交易会在一段时间后完成。

                4. 如何导出TCC比特币钱包的私钥?

                导出私钥的步骤相对简单,首先打开TCC比特币钱包,进入钱包设置和管理页面。在设置中选择密钥管理,你会找到私钥的导出选项。确保在导出过程中将私钥存放于安全的地方,切勿随意公开,因为私钥的泄漏将导致比特币被盗。

                5. TCC比特币钱包支持哪些操作系统?

                TCC比特币钱包主要支持在Windows、macOS与Linux操作系统下运行,因此用户可以根据自己的操作设备选择适合的版本进行安装。确保在合适的系统环境中使用,可以有效提升使用体验。

                通过以上的介绍,相信大家对TCC比特币钱包的编译和使用有了更加全面的认识。无论是对技术开发者还是普通用户,了解这一工具都有其独特的价值,能够增强自己的比特币管理能力,也为进一步探索区块链技术打下坚实基础。

                • Tags
                • 比特币钱包,TCC,钱包编译